Departure from San Miguel de Allende
We will go to your hotel to pick you up to start our journey to San Miguel de Allende, this beautiful city formerly called Villa San Miguel el Grande, preserves a magic that takes us back to the ostentatious past, founded in 1542, it has witnessed and participated in great events that have decided the course of the history of Mexico, land of great heroes, thinkers, artists and dreamers, has managed to spend this century with its Otomi and Chichimeca roots that enrich daily life, and fill its parties, festivals and traditions with mysticism, A walk through its cobbled and colorful streets will lead you to discover beautiful buildings and majestic churches adorning warm squares and gardens, its ingenious handicrafts, its hot springs, its mild climate, incredible landscapes, the taste of its food and the warmth of its people make of this a peculiar unimaginable, fun, cultural, culinary, rest and pleasure destination turning your vacations into everything gives a unique experience.
Visit: Mirador de la Ciudad, El Manantial del Chorro, Instituto Allende, Ignacio Ramírez El Nigromante Cultural Center, Church of the Purísima Concepción, Ángela Peralta Theater, San Felipe Neri Oratory, Civic Square, San Francisco de Asís Temple, Main Square (Parish of San Miguel Arcángel, House of Ignacio Allende, Palacio del Mayorazgo de la Canal, Municipal Presidency and Main Garden.).
We return and end at your hotel.

Departure from Mazatlán
We will leave very early to move to the city of Durango. The operator will pick you up at the Hotel.
During the road trip, you will see the imposing Baluarte bridge with a height of 402.57 meters, being the highest cable-stayed bridge in the world and we will pass through the Sinaloan tunnel with a length of almost 3 kilometers. Upon arriving in the city we will visit the museum of the revolutionary hero Pancho Villa, we will visit the most representative temples, squares and civil buildings of the historic center to finish at the colorful Gómez Palacio market and taste the gastronomy.
At the end of the day we return to Mazatlán to drop you off at your Hotel.

Departure from Oaxaca de Juárez
The meeting point is at the Exconvent of Santo Domingo in Oaxaca, you must arrive 10 minutes before the start time.
Our tour begins by visiting the Temple of Santo Domingo de Guzmán, a monumental architectural complex of the Dominican Order, undoubtedly one of the most beautiful examples of baroque in Mexico.
We continue on foot along the Tourist Walkway, from Santo Domingo de Guzmán to the center of the City, where various museums, galleries, craft shops and restaurants are located.
In the center we can enjoy the Music Band and Marimba, which play in the Kiosk of the Zócalo, we will visit the portals of the center, in the Garden of the Constitution.
Continuing our tour on foot, we will arrive at a chocolate shop, where in addition to learning how Oaxacan chocolate is made, we can make our own grinding.
We will visit the Benito Juárez market, the most traditional in the city, where you can buy the famous “Mole oaxaqueño” (oaxacan mole), quesillo and chapulines. Then we will go into the 20 de noviembre market where we will see the famous “Pasillo de Humo” (smoke hall).
